How do I hire an IHSS provider?

How do I hire an IHSS provider?

Find an IHSS Provider Tell the Public Authority counselor your preferences and care needs when they call. Get a list of five recommended IHSS Providers from the counselor. Interview them by phone to determine who is the best fit for you. You can call your IHSS Public Authority counselor with questions.

What is the in-Home Supportive Services Program?

What is IHSS? The In-Home Supportive Services (IHSS) program arranges for and helps pay for services to enable elderly, blind or disabled persons to live safely and independently in their own homes. The Fresno County IHSS program is considered an alternative to out-of-home care, such as nursing homes or board and care facilities.

How do I reset my IP address using CMD?

On a Windows computer: Click Start > Run and type cmd in the Open field, then press Enter. (If prompted, select Run as administrator.) Type ipconfig /release and press Enter. Type ipconfig /renew and press Enter.

    What does weightlessness mean in physics?

    weightlessness, condition experienced while in free-fall, in which the effect of gravity is canceled by the inertial (e.g., centrifugal) force resulting from orbital flight. The term zero gravity is often used to describe such a condition.

    What is real weightlessness?

    It occurs only when an object is not subjected to any gravitational force . For example , if the astronaut is very far from the Earth and other astronomical objects, then g = 0, and there is true weightlessness.

    What causes weightlessness?

    To create the sensation of weightlessness, the pilot sets thrust equal to drag and eliminates lift. At this point, the only unbalanced force acting on the plane is weight, so the plane and its passengers are in free fall. This is what creates the zero-g experience.

    What is the difference between free fall and weightlessness?

    When in free fall, the only force acting upon your body is the force of gravity a non-contact force. Weightlessness is the complete or near-complete absence of the sensation of weight. This is also termed zero-G, although the more correct term is “zero G-force”. It occurs in the absence of any contact forces upon objects including the human body.

    How does IRI collect data?

    Info scan – Each week several thousand grocery, drug, and department stores deliver the product data collected by their scanners. IRI sorts, analyzes, and verifies product price and volume, and then delivers final Info scan sales information to its customers via tape, disk, or on-line service.

    What size baseball glove should my kid have?

    A 5- or 6-year-old requires a glove that is 10 to 10 1/2 inches. A 7- or 8-year-old needs a glove that is 10 1/2 to 11 inches. A 9- to 12-year-old needs a glove that is 11 to 11 1/2 inches. A high school-aged child normally wears a glove between 10 1/2 to 11 1/2 inches.

    How do you determine baseball glove size?

    Every baseball mitt has the size etched in the leather on the thumb or pinky finger of the glove. Manufacturers measure their creations from the top of the index finger and move down along the glove until it reaches the center of the heel. That length is how the glove’s size is determined.

    How often should I chew xylitol gum?

    How often must I use xylitol for it to be effective? Xylitol gum or mints used 3-5 times daily, for a total intake of 5 grams, is considered optimal. Because frequency and duration of exposure is important, gum should be chewed for approximately 5 minutes and mints should be allowed to dissolve.

    What is the difference between conjunctions and disjunctions?

    For conjunctions, both statements must be true for the compound statement to be true. When your two statements are combined with an ‘or,’ you have a disjunction. For disjunctions, only one of the statements needs to be true for the compound statement to be true.

    Why is my hermit crab half out of his shell?

    Stress, an inhospitable environment, a poor-fitting shell (too large, too small, too heavy), fungus, or uninvited company can all cause a hermit crab to leave its shell. When this happens, the homeless crab suddenly becomes exposed to its surroundings, which is bad for its health.

    What does a hermit crab look like when molting?

    As molting time approaches, the crab’s gel limb will expand and become more defined. Legs and claws may seem droopy or weak. Eye stalks may face away from each other in a “V” shape rather than being parallel. They may also appear cloudy, white-ish, and dull, like a human’s cataract.
